The CPS1000-CM optimizes storage, streaming and network resources, and improves fault resiliency for a cluster of co-located or geographically distributed cluster elements.
CPS1000-CM utilizes Adaptive Media Management, our approach to intelligent distribution of content and streaming resources, across the appropriate storage and streaming technologies.
Highlights
- Intelligently manages placement of content and streams across the on-demand network
- Optimizes streaming, storage and network resources through Adaptive Media Management
- Supports multiple storage architectures for maximum flexibility
- Distributes content both proactively based on metadata and reactively based on usage patterns
- Uses prevailing industry standards designed to support third-party servers
Key Features
Proactive Content Placement
- Reliable, full replication of content across an entire cluster
- Rules-Driven Content Placement optimizes placement of content in cluster based on metadata
Reactive Content Placement
- Library Balancer ensures all servers have the entire library in a fully replicated environment
- Demand-Driven Content Placement uses usage statistics to best position content across the cluster.
Stream Placement Options
- Content Affinity Load Balancing assigns streams to servers currently streaming the content to more efficiently use streaming resources and storage bandwidth
- Automatically redirects streams to most efficient resource
- Supports propagate and stream when local server does not have required content
Fault Resiliency
- Automatically retries failed streams on another server in the cluster
- Distributed deployment model eliminates single point of failure for centralized ingest and stream processing
- Automatically detects and recovers from possible failure scenarios
- Enables the creation of seamless maintenance windows for servers in the cluster
Storage Architecture Supported
Fully Replicated
- Replicates entire library on each server
- Single point of ingest saves bandwidth
- Library Balancing maintains content synchronization
- Stream Affinity selects optimal server to minimize streaming resources and optimize storage bandwidth
- Improved fault tolerance/resiliency
Shared Storage
- Central storage of entire library
- Rules-Driven Content Placement proactively places content on servers in optimized fashion
- Demand-Driven Content Placement reactively optimizes content placement
- Supports Library Server (NAS w/ NFS, CIFS, etc.)
- Directs stream requests to server with content or propagates to “local” server
Technical Specifications
Back Offices Supported
- Integrated Services Architecture (ISA):
- Tandberg OpenStream®
- Time Warner Mystro Business Management Server (BMS)
- Comcast Next Generation On Demand (NGOD)
- eventIS stagIS/prodIS/traxIS
- Motorola TSX1000
Hardware Specifications
Dell PowerEdge 2950 server with the following specifications:
- (2) Dual-core Xeon 2.33 GHz 64-bit processors
- 4 GB DRAM
- (3) 73 GB 15K RPM hard drives configured as RAID-5
